Not wholly happy on just a new album coming out, M.I.A has taken time to design a new clothing line for fashion house Versace.
Versace really have been bigged up by the music industry lately, with this new range hitting store on 16 October. The theme of the collection is “counterfeits”, as in Versace copying their own copies.
“The theme of counterfeits, of those that produce and sell them has always been part of the culture of M.I.A.,” the musician said of the designs. “When I was contacted by Versace, it seemed a great idea to invert the circle. Versace’s designs have always been copied, now it’s Versace that copies the copies, so those that copy must copy the copies. So this will continue.”
